What temperature does Red Star Premier Blanc ferment at?

Answered by Michael Weatherspoon

The Red Star Premier Blanc is a fantastic choice for those looking to produce or champagne. This high-performance yeast is specifically designed for this purpose and can help you achieve excellent results in your fermentation process.

One of the key factors to consider when using this yeast is the fermentation temperature. The optimal temperature range for the Premier Blanc yeast is between 60 to 80 degrees Fahrenheit. This range allows for a controlled and efficient fermentation process, ensuring the yeast can thrive and produce the desired results.

Fermenting at lower temperatures, closer to the lower end of the range, around 60 to 65 degrees Fahrenheit, can result in a slower fermentation process. This can be beneficial in certain situations, as it allows for a more gradual release of flavors and aromas, leading to a more complex and well-rounded final product.

On the other hand, fermenting at higher temperatures, closer to the upper end of the range, around 75 to 80 degrees Fahrenheit, can result in a faster fermentation process. This can be advantageous when time is a limiting factor, as it allows for a quicker turnaround and production of your sparkling wine or champagne.

It is important to note that maintaining a consistent fermentation temperature is crucial for the success of your fermentation. Fluctuations in temperature can lead to off-flavors or stalled fermentation. Using a temperature-controlled environment, such as a fermentation chamber or a temperature-controlled fermentation vessel, can help you achieve and maintain the desired temperature throughout the fermentation process.
